KPIL's Order Book Swells with ₹3,789 Crore New Contracts.
Kalpataru Projects International Ltd (KPIL) announced recently that the company, along with its international subsidiaries, has secured new orders totaling a substantial ₹3,789 crore. This significant inflow of contracts further strengthens KPIL's diverse project portfolio.
A major highlight of these new wins is a landmark contract within KPIL's Buildings and Factories (B&F) business in India. This order represents the company's largest B&F project to date, encompassing the design and build development of over 12 million square feet of residential buildings along with associated facilities. This significant undertaking underscores KPIL's growing capabilities in large-scale urban development projects.
In addition to the domestic B&F success, KPIL has also secured new orders in the Power Transmission & Distribution (T&D) sector within the overseas market. While specific details of these international T&D projects were not immediately disclosed, they signal the company's continued global reach and expertise in critical infrastructure development.
